词源 | tradition [LME] A tradition is something passed on and comes from Latin from tradere ‘deliver’ formed from trans- ‘across’ and dare ‘give’. The abbreviation trad dates from the 1950s, usually in the context of jazz. Traitor [ME], someone who hands over things to the enemy, and treason [ME] the act of handing over, are from the same root. |
